    Interactivity:light only when necessaryTo adapt lighting to real needs, our solutions include sensors. They measure naturallight levels, movement or speed to provide light only where and when it is necessary.This feature enables you to avoid unnecessary lighting in favour of energy savings.

    Daylight sensorsOur solutions can be managed by photoelectric sensorsthat switch on the luminaires exactly when natural lightbecomes insufcient (cloudy day, night fall) so as to

    provide safety and well-being in the public space.

    Movement sensorsIn non-linear activity areas (squares, car parks, resi-dential streets... places with a little nocturnal activity),the lighting can be dimmed to a minimum most of thetime. By using movement sensors, levels can be raisedas soon as a pedestrian or a slow vehicle is detectedin the area. This light-on-demand function enhances

    the safety and the well-being of the users while savingenergy.

    Speed and direction sensorsCompared to movement sensors, a speed (and direc-tion) sensor works with a wider detection area to clas-sify the identied moving item following its speedand its direction. This classication provides the right

    response according to predened lighting scenarios.Solutions tted with speed and direction sensors oper-ate in large areas to ensure safety and well-being in themost sustainable way.

    PhotocellPlaced on the top of the luminaire, an integrated photo-

    cell switches it ON or OFF depending on the level ofnatural light. Each light point behaves independently. Aphotocell enables an out of the box installation withoutcommissioning. Thus it is very easy to retrot in existingluminaires.

    Motion detection sensorsThe presence of people or vehicles is detected by motionsensors (infrared/microwaves). Besides reducing energyconsumption, this light-on-demand feature contributesto the safety of an area. Each sensor is set up to avoidunnecessary detection.

    OwletSTAND-ALONE solutionsOne pole, one controlEach luminaire behaves independently thanks to its own control unit. Schrder Owlet stand-alonesolutions are recommended for basic smart lighting. in non-linear activity areas such as pedestrianareas, parks, car parks, warehouses...

    Intelligent driver with Constant LightOutput (CLO)To comply with required lighting levels, newly installedlamps emit more light than necessary in order to takeinto account the further depreciation of the ux. TheConstant Light Output (CLO) feature eliminates over-lighting and autonomously compensates the deprecia-tion.

    Astronomical clock An integrated astronomical clock offers a constant adap-tation of the dimming prole according to the seasons. Itensures that the lighting meets the real needs every day.

    Intelligent driver with scheduleddimming Intelligent drivers integrating optimum 5-level dimmingprograms can be incorporated into luminaires. The driv-ers work autonomously by taking switch-on and switch-offtimes as reference points.

    OwletAUTONOMOUS NETWORK

    To manage a communicating network To offer more exibility with stand-alone features and a wider scope of possibilities in terms of interaction, theSchrder Owlet range incorporates an Autonomous Network Dimming system.

    Luminaires communicate together in a wireless network to offer dynamic prole dimming. The autonomous dimmingscenario can be enhanced with motion detection features. To pilot the installation, the sensors can be centralised ordecentralised. When motion is detected, the detection scenario supplants the dimming scenario in order to providesafety and comfort for the users.

    The Owlet autonomous network is perfectly suited for squares, car parks, city parks, warehouses, sports elds,roads, streets

    1. EfciencyThe wireless network is based on the open source ZigBeeprotocol. It communicates 50 times faster than a power-line network by using 16 communications channels, eachwith maximum bandwidth.

    2. ReliabilityThanks to mesh functionality, the wireless network ndsthe best communication path. The system includes self-healing and re-routing features. Even in the worst casescenarios, the data transmission rate remains 10 timeshigher compared to a powerline communication withoutinterference.

    3. FreedomA network based on wireless technology offers completefreedom to incorporate sensors and luminaires. Itprovides an optimised installation for the best dimmingscenario.

    4. UpgradabilityThe network can be upgraded by adding new features. Itcan also easily be enlarged by incorporating new lightingpoints, independently of the electricity supply withoutcabling thanks to wireless ZigBee communication.

    5. AccessibilityThe dimming prole can easily be changed by simplyconnecting wirelessly a laptop to one luminaire withoutusing any tools. The new conguration will be deployedto all the luminaires in the network.

    Complete telemanagement system withuser-friendly interfaceOwlet Nightshift is a telemanagement system for moni-toring, controlling, metering and managing a lightingnetwork. It is a unique combination of future orientedtechnologies and an easy-to-use web interface. OwletNightshift provides advanced solutions to operate alighting installation remotely from anywhere in theworld.

    The lighting network is managed through the internetvia a simple web browser. Each individual light pointcan be controlled at any time. Thanks to bi-directionalcommunication, operating status, energy consumptionand possible failures can be monitored.

    SecurityThe advanced Nightshift system provides a secured datastorage and a back-up. The system uses bank gradesecurity mechanisms to encrypt data while using stan-dard web browsers.

    Reporting Events are stored in the database with an exact timestamp and geographical location. The reports can be pre-dened or customised to focus on the most interestinginformation. This feature provides an efcient alarm andasset management to prevent small failures developinginto major problems and to detect vandalism of theft.

    Third party integrationThanks to its open source Zigbee technology and its ex-ible MySQL workow, the Nightshift system can easilybe associated to third party ERP systems integratedthrough data bridges. This exibility increases the func-tionalities far beyond lighting.

    Fall-back scenarioIn case of control issues, the system switches to adefault program ensuring that the lighting installationdoes not turn off and continues to provide safety in thepublic space.

    Data managementAll the feedback of the lighting scheme is stored in aMySQL database making the data available for long termevaluations like energy analysis, lamp life time forecast-ing, problem detection,

    Instant Alarm Management

    Failures are recorded, identied and localised in real-time. Information can be automatically sent to operatorsby a mobile telephone call, SMS or mail.

    Absolute compatibilityAny type of lamp, ballast or LED driver magnetic gear,bi-power, step-down, electronic ballast with or without1-10V interface or DALI can be managed by Owlet Night-shift.

    LED Conversion ProgrammeSan Jos launched an innovative lighting plan to replaceits yellow sodium ttings with LED luminaires. Thisprogressive conversion started in 2011 with the goal ofchanging 62,000 luminaires by 2022. To be even moreefcient, the local authorities were keen to combine thenew lighting scheme with an adaptive control system.They were impressed by Owlets solutions and choseSchrder to help maximise energy savings. When thesolution is fully deployed, San Jos will have decreasedits energy consumption by more than 50%.

    Reduced operational and maintenancecostsIn 2010, San Jos spent more than 6 million dollars onmaintenance operations. The city was forced to replaceor repair 13,000 luminaires. It was denitely time tothink differently. The local authorities decided to makeSan Jos smarter and more environmentally friendly byembracing advanced technology. San Jos has adoptedOwlet solutions to control, to metre and to monitor itslighting network in the most efcient way. Today, thecity has improved its asset management and is now ableto dim its lights in the late evening hours when there islittle or no trafc. The quality of lighting has improved,providing more safety and well-being for the inhabitants.At the same time, the energy bill and the CO2 emissionshave been signicantly reduced.

    Case study San Jos (USA)

    Schrder,partner of Silicon Valley

    San Jos, California - capital of Silicon Valley, home to many of the worlds largest technologycorporations and cradle of the digital revolution - trusts the Owlets solutions to achieve itsambitious target of zero emissions from its streetlights.

    Zero Emission StreetlightsSince 2007, San Jos has developed a Green Visionprogramme whose aims, amongst others, are to reduceenergy consumption, eliminate light pollution andprotect the night sky. The Californian metropolis isconvinced that improved public lighting will bring signi-cant environmental and social benets to the community.By offering this innovative management solution, Owletis helping San Jos to reach its goal of Zero EmissionStreetlights. By 2022, the city plans to become carbonneutral by supplying 100% of its electricity from renew-able sources and by planting no less than 100,000 trees.
